Build Reusable Business Mapping Skill in Claude Cowork

Add a custom connector in Claude Cowork: Go to Customize > Connectors > Add Custom Connector, name it, and enter mcp.draw.io/mcp. This enables AI-generated diagrams via draw.io integration.

Extract Workflows from Transcripts for Instant Diagrams

Upload interview transcripts directly into Claude Cowork after invoking /business workflow. Provide minimal context like "Run the business workflow plugin with these transcripts," and let the skill process them.

For a SaaS company like Metaflow (185 employees), it auto-generates a master diagram plus department-specific ones: proposal creation, QBRs, sales cycles, engineering handoffs to CTO/lead/production, and AI/tool futures. Outputs seven detailed swimlane maps showing roles (e.g., engineer to CTO) and processes with arrows for flow.

Processing takes ~15 minutes while you multitask, versus 5-7 hours manually. The skill identifies overlaps automatically but flags them for quick human tweaks, ensuring diagrams reflect real business flows without starting from blank canvases.

Trade-off: Raw outputs are XML code—import to diagrams.net (File > Import from Device) to visualize tabs for each map. Minor drags (e.g., overlapping elements) fix in seconds by nudging shapes, reclaiming massive time for consultants or owners auditing processes.
